March 15, 2013 at 5:06 pmFinal Cut X is still an NLE and not a media asset manager. Perhaps, some day, multiple users will be able to draw from a central Event, but I wouldn’t count on it.
Perhaps take a look at Cantemo Portal as a media asset manager. Or CatDV.

FCP X is NOT an asset management tool. The collections, searches, etc. are only specific to the events loaded by a single editor.
